Brighton & Hove Food Partnership are looking for volunteers to help us at Stanmer Wellbeing Gardens. We are looking for adults who don’t mind getting stuck in and like to do physical outdoor activity.

Stanmer Wellbeing Gardens is our 4.5 acre site at Stanmer Park which is shared with 13 community groups. Our aims for the site are to have a thriving, community space where people can find sanctuary and nurture wellbeing through the provision of food-growing, gardening, education and nature connection activities.

We will be undertaking a mix of woodland conservation, gardening and practical activities. This is to transform currently unused parts of our site into community spaces.

The kind of things you can expect to get involved in:

• Bramble bashing and weeding

• Fire tending

• Coppicing & pruning

• Making pathways

• Planting hedgerows, herbs and flowers

• Meeting our friendly group of volunteers

Please bring clothes which are suitable for the weather and you don’t mind getting dirty or torn, sturdy boots and long-sleeved tops are also a good idea (there are nettles!). Please bring your own gardening gloves if you have them.
